Its skin is very hard, so it is unhurt even if stepped on by sumo wrestlers. It smiles when transmitting electricity.
It conceals itself in the mud of the seashore. Then it waits. When prey touch it, it delivers a jolt of electricity.
When its opponent can’t be paralyzed, it contorts itself with unexpected speed and flops away.
Thanks to bacteria that lived in the mud flats with it, this Pokémon developed the organs it uses to generate electricity.
For some reason, this Pokémon smiles slightly when it emits a strong electric current from the yellow markings on its body.

About Stunfisk
Stunfisk is a Ground/Electric-type Pokemon introduced in Generation 5. With a Base Stat Total (BST) of 471, Stunfisk is classified as a Trap Pokémon and is part of the Stunfisk → Galarian Stunfisk evolution line.
In competitive play, Stunfisk is placed in the NatDex tier where it holds a 0.02% usage rate. Its key abilities are Static and Limber and Sand Veil, which allow it to function as a versatile team member. Stunfisk is weak to Water, Grass, Ice, Ground-type moves, so trainers should plan around these vulnerabilities.
Stunfisk can learn 74 moves across Level-up, TM, Tutor, and Egg methods. Its most popular competitive moves include Earth Power, Discharge, Thunder Wave, Stealth Rock. Standing at 0.7m tall and weighing 11kg, Stunfisk has been a fan favorite since its debut in the Unova region games.
